Los Angeles — May 9, 2013 — Since November 2012, Operation HOPE’s disaster preparedness and recovery division, HOPE Coalition America (HCA), has provided Disaster Financial Recovery personal counseling for 11,069 individuals and reached out to an additional 38,266 survivors referred by the American Red Cross for financial guidance and assistance, the financial dignity nonprofit announced today. These figures mark the initial efforts of HCA’s two year plan to provide services to individuals and small businesses affected by Hurricane Sandy in October, 2012. 
 
Through Operation HOPE’s disaster preparedness and recovery division, HOPE Coalition America (HCA), free financial recovery information and guidance is available for individuals and small business owners through a national toll free assistance hotline 888-388-HOPE (4673).
